Cheilopogon arcticeps (Günther, 1866) White-finned flyingfish |

| Family: | Exocoetidae (Flyingfishes) | |||
| Max. size: | 21 cm SL (male/unsexed) | |||
| Environment: | pelagic-neritic; marine; depth range 0 - 20 m, oceanodromous | |||
| Distribution: | Western Pacific: Southern China, Viet Nam, Thailand, Indonesia, near the Philippines, New Guinea, and Solomon Islands. | |||
| Diagnosis: | ||||
| Biology: | Found in near-shore surface waters, never spread to open sea (Ref. 9839). | |||
| IUCN Red List Status: | Not Evaluated (N.E.) Ref. (130435) | |||
| Threat to humans: | harmless | |||
